  • COURSE TAUGHT
    Law of Commercial Transactions and Debtor-Creditor Relationships
    12 Jan 2026 - 1 May 2026
    Concentrated study of law relating to certain commercial transactions and debtor/creditor relationships. Includes law of sales, negotiable instruments, secured transactions, suretyship and bankruptcy. Previously offered as LSB 3323 and BUSL 3323.Prerequisite(s): LSB 3213.
  • COURSE TAUGHT
    Legal and Regulatory Environment of Business
    12 Jan 2026 - 1 May 2026
    General concepts regarding the nature of the legal system, ethical issues in business decision making, dispute resolution processes, basic constitutional limitations on the power of government to regulate business activity, the nature of government regulation, fundamental principles of tort and contract law. Course previously offered as BUSL 3213.Prerequisite(s): Junior standing.
